Henry Wiltshire are pleased to present this Studio apartment is located on the 8th floor and benefits from a west-facing balcony, which is ideal for enjoying afternoon sunshine. The open plan layout of this home provides a bright and airy feel, the kitchen is elegantly designed and also fully fitted with integrated appliances. The bathroom and bedroom are contemporary and bright, there is also space for a home workstation should you need one.
Life at Hayes Village provides residents' with the village lifestyle with 9 acres of green space, a residents' gym so you can keep fit at your convenience - whilst being just 20 minutes from Paddington via the Elizabeth Line.

020 8128 9821Described as west London’s most up and coming commuter belt, Hayes & Harlington’s inclusion on the Crossrail network (operational from 2018) is set to transform the area’s neighbourhoods. With the new line offering greatly reduced commuting times into the City, West End and Canary Wharf properties in Hayes & Harlington offer great potential capital growth and a growing demand for rentals. Benefitting from its proximity to Heathrow airport, the area has become a magnet for regeneration, aided by a recent three-year improvement programme that has changed the former manufacturing town and surrounding localities remarkably. Also close by is the renowned Stockley Park business estate, one of the largest logistic centres in west London. This pocket of west London, known most for its proximity to Heathrow, boasts its own self-contained community of high-street shops, independent retail, theatre, cinema and recreational spaces aplenty. The Grand Union Canal, Minet’s Country Park and the National Trust owned Osterley Park offer quiet tranquil backdrops, contributing to the area’s village-like atmosphere.
